Overview:
The Ace 1/4 in. SAE Nut Driver is an essential tool for both professional mechanics and DIY enthusiasts. With a length of 7 inches, this nut driver is designed to efficiently fasten and loosen nuts and bolts in various applications, making it a versatile addition to your toolbox. Crafted from durable alloy steel, it ensures longevity and reliability, even under heavy use.

Key Features:
- Durable Construction: Made from high-quality alloy steel for maximum strength and durability.
- Ergonomic Design: Features an acetate handle that is chemical resistant, providing a secure and comfortable grip.
- Versatile Use: Ideal for both mechanic and maintenance settings, as well as household applications.
- Enhanced Torque: Functions like a screwdriver, allowing you to apply added torque to stubborn hardware.
- 6-Point Socket: Designed to fit a variety of nuts and bolts securely, preventing slippage during use.
